PRI_RESERVATION_DESCRIPTOR 結構 (storport.h)

PRI_RESERVATION_DESCRIPTOR 結構可用來建構傳回 的 PRI_RESERVATION_LIST 結構,以回應 ServiceAction = RESERVATION_ACTION_READ_RESERVATIONS的 Persistent Reserve In 命令。

語法

typedef struct {
  UCHAR ReservationKey[8];
  UCHAR ScopeSpecificAddress[4];
  UCHAR Reserved;
  UCHAR Type : 4;
  UCHAR Scope : 4;
  UCHAR Obsolete[2];
} PRI_RESERVATION_DESCRIPTOR, *PPRI_RESERVATION_DESCRIPTOR;

成員

ReservationKey[8]

保留保留的保留金鑰。

ScopeSpecificAddress[4]

ScopeSpecificAddress 欄位包含元素位址,其中零放在最顯著位以符合字段。

Reserved

保留的。 必須為零。

Type

持續性保留的類型,如建立永續性保留的Persistent Reserve Out命令所示。

Scope

持續性保留的範圍,如建立永續性保留的Persistent Reserve Out命令所示。

Obsolete[2]

保留的。 必須為零。

備註

IOCTL_STORAGE_PERSISTENT_RESERVE_IN要求可用來取得裝置伺服器記憶體中持續性保留和保留密鑰的相關信息。

規格需求

需求
標頭 storport.h (包含 Ntddstor.h、Minitape.h、Scsi.h)

另請參閱

IOCTL_STORAGE_PERSISTENT_RESERVE_IN

PRI_RESERVATION_LIST